New Orleans Events – Friday, Jan. 16

NEW ORLEANS (AP) – Associated Press Louisiana Daybook for Friday, Jan. 16.

 

FORESTRY FORUM — The annual forestry forum held in conjunction with the AgExpo will be held, 8:00 a.m. – 12:00 p.m. Location: West Monroe Convention Center, 901 Ridge Ave., West Monroe.

GOVERNOR'S FORUM — Four announced major candidates for Louisiana governor — Public Service Commissioner Scott Angelle, Lt. Gov. Jay Dardenne, state Rep. John Bel Edwards and U.S. Sen. David Vitter — will debate transportation and infrastructure issues, 10:00 a.m. Location: Renaissance Baton Rouge Hotel, 7000 Bluebonnett Blvd., Baton Rouge.
